Job Summary:
Leads assigned staff in performing activities or tasks in cardiovascular perfusion services.

Job Responsibilities and Requirements:

P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Leads or coordinates shift operations of assigned activities, resources, and staff.
  • Serves as a technical or functional resource.
  • Assigns, monitors and reviews progress of work. Monitors and reports compliance with policies and/or procedures.
  • Oversees and evaluates orientation and training of assigned staff. May provide input in the review and evaluation of staff performance.
  • May perform the duties of a perfusionist.
  • Works in a constant state of alertness and safe manner.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.

P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S
  • Constant standing and walking.
  • Frequent lifting/carrying and pushing/pulling objects weighing 0-25 lbs.
  • Frequent reaching, gripping and keyboard use/data entry.
  • Frequent use of vision for distances near (20 inches or less) and far (20 feet or more).
  • Frequent use of hearing and speech to share information through oral communication. Ability to hear alarms, malfunctioning machinery, etc.
  • Occasional bending, stooping, climbing, crawling, kneeling, sitting, squatting, twisting and repetitive foot/leg and hand/arm movements.
  • Occasional lifting/carrying and pushing/pulling objects weighing 25-50 lbs.
  • Occasional use of vision to judge distances and spatial relationships and to identify and distinguish colors.
  • Rare use of smell to detect/recognize odors.
  • Rare driving.
